


KPV Peptide Therapy
Anti-Inflammatory | Skin Repair | Barrier Support
Description:
KPV (Lysine-Proline-Valine) is a powerful anti-inflammatory tripeptide that helps reduce cytokine activity, calm inflammation, and support tissue repair — making it ideal for inflammatory skin conditions, surgical healing, and wound recovery.
Unlike peptides that promote growth factor signaling or angiogenesis, KPV works by modulating the immune response, which is especially useful in wounds or conditions where inflammation is contributing to delayed healing or skin breakdown.
Clinical Uses:
Chronic wounds with signs of inflammation
Eczema or atopic dermatitis-related excoriations
Psoriatic flares or fragile post-rash skin
Post-procedure or laser recovery
IBD-related skin inflammation or perianal irritation
Why It Works:
Reduces pro-inflammatory cytokines (like TNF-alpha and IL-6)
Calms local immune responses without suppressing healing
Supports epithelial regeneration and barrier repair
